Vue.js 是一個輕量級的 JavaScript 框架,可以用於開發優秀的用戶界面。它提供了一個簡單的方法來創建和管理路由,並提供了一個路由導航系統,可以讓您在應用程序中輕鬆地導航。本文將介紹如何在 Vue 中使用路由和路由導航。
安裝 Vue Router
首先,您需要安裝 Vue Router,它是一個用於在 Vue 應用程序中創建路由的插件。您可以使用 npm 或 yarn 來安裝 Vue Router:
npm install vue-router yarn add vue-router
創建路由
接下來,您需要創建一個路由對象,它將包含您應用程序中的所有路由。您可以使用 Vue Router 的 routes
選項來創建路由對象:
const router = new VueRouter({ routes: [ { path: '/', component: HomePage }, { path: '/about', component: AboutPage } ] })
上面的代碼創建了一個路由對象,它包含了兩個路由:一個對應到 /
路徑,另一個對應到 /about
路徑。每個路由都有一個對應的組件,當用戶訪問該路徑時,將會顯示該組件。
導航
現在,您可以使用 Vue Router 的 <router-link>
組件來創建導航鏈接:
Home About
上面的代碼將創建兩個鏈接,當用戶點擊鏈接時,將會導航到對應的路徑。
導入路由
最後,您需要將路由對象導入到 Vue 應用程序中:
const app = new Vue({ router }).$mount('#app')
上面的代碼將路由對象導入到 Vue 應用程序中,並將其鏈接到 #app
元素。
總結
在本文中,您學習了如何在 Vue 中使用路由和路由導航。您可以使用 Vue Router 來創建路由,並使用 <router-link>
組件來創建導航鏈接。